diff options
author | Friedemann Kleint <Friedemann.Kleint@qt.io> | 2016-12-21 11:39:57 +0100 |
---|---|---|
committer | Friedemann Kleint <Friedemann.Kleint@qt.io> | 2017-01-10 12:29:40 +0000 |
commit | a5fda7eecc3ce4c0b0125224ac20ea8880c6450c (patch) | |
tree | 0fe8dbcc2b465390e7d4c471d05004fdca5e4b87 /src/designer/src/designer/qdesigner_workbench.cpp | |
parent | 4acf08bbd347d0793f57efb92b7267c5c0b6454c (diff) |
Qt Designer: Remove foreach
Use range based for.
Change-Id: I61a51aad99a9b2a20263fa3fa5ed991ac899ff2e
Reviewed-by: Jarek Kobus <jaroslaw.kobus@qt.io>
Diffstat (limited to 'src/designer/src/designer/qdesigner_workbench.cpp')
-rw-r--r-- | src/designer/src/designer/qdesigner_workbench.cpp | 45 |
1 files changed, 21 insertions, 24 deletions
diff --git a/src/designer/src/designer/qdesigner_workbench.cpp b/src/designer/src/designer/qdesigner_workbench.cpp index 493a4c0e1..b85b49c0b 100644 --- a/src/designer/src/designer/qdesigner_workbench.cpp +++ b/src/designer/src/designer/qdesigner_workbench.cpp @@ -270,21 +270,18 @@ void QDesignerWorkbench::saveGeometriesForModeChange() break; case TopLevelMode: { const QPoint desktopOffset = QApplication::desktop()->availableGeometry().topLeft(); - foreach (QDesignerToolWindow *tw, m_toolWindows) + for (QDesignerToolWindow *tw : qAsConst(m_toolWindows)) m_Positions.insert(tw, Position(tw, desktopOffset)); - foreach (QDesignerFormWindow *fw, m_formWindows) { + for (QDesignerFormWindow *fw : qAsConst(m_formWindows)) m_Positions.insert(fw, Position(fw, desktopOffset)); - } } break; case DockedMode: { const QPoint mdiAreaOffset = m_dockedMainWindow->mdiArea()->pos(); - foreach (QDesignerToolWindow *tw, m_toolWindows) { + for (QDesignerToolWindow *tw : qAsConst(m_toolWindows)) m_Positions.insert(tw, Position(dockWidgetOf(tw))); - } - foreach (QDesignerFormWindow *fw, m_formWindows) { + for (QDesignerFormWindow *fw : qAsConst(m_formWindows)) m_Positions.insert(fw, Position(mdiSubWindowOf(fw), mdiAreaOffset)); - } } break; } @@ -374,12 +371,12 @@ void QDesignerWorkbench::switchToNeutralMode() m_mode = NeutralMode; - foreach (QDesignerToolWindow *tw, m_toolWindows) { + for (QDesignerToolWindow *tw : qAsConst(m_toolWindows)) { tw->setCloseEventPolicy(MainWindowBase::AcceptCloseEvents); tw->setParent(0); } - foreach (QDesignerFormWindow *fw, m_formWindows) { + for (QDesignerFormWindow *fw : qAsConst(m_formWindows)) { fw->setParent(0); fw->setMaximumSize(QWIDGETSIZE_MAX, QWIDGETSIZE_MAX); } @@ -432,7 +429,7 @@ void QDesignerWorkbench::switchToDockedMode() #endif qDesigner->setMainWindow(m_dockedMainWindow); - foreach (QDesignerFormWindow *fw, m_formWindows) { + for (QDesignerFormWindow *fw : qAsConst(m_formWindows)) { QMdiSubWindow *subwin = m_dockedMainWindow->createMdiSubWindow(fw, magicalWindowFlags(fw), m_actionManager->closeFormAction()->shortcut()); subwin->hide(); @@ -452,7 +449,7 @@ void QDesignerWorkbench::adjustMDIFormPositions() { const QPoint mdiAreaOffset = m_dockedMainWindow->mdiArea()->pos(); - foreach (QDesignerFormWindow *fw, m_formWindows) { + for (QDesignerFormWindow *fw : qAsConst(m_formWindows)) { const PositionMap::const_iterator pit = m_Positions.constFind(fw); if (pit != m_Positions.constEnd()) pit->applyTo(mdiSubWindowOf(fw), mdiAreaOffset); @@ -506,7 +503,7 @@ void QDesignerWorkbench::switchToTopLevelMode() widgetBoxWrapper->restoreState(settings.mainWindowState(m_mode), MainWindowBase::settingsVersion()); bool found_visible_window = false; - foreach (QDesignerToolWindow *tw, m_toolWindows) { + for (QDesignerToolWindow *tw : qAsConst(m_toolWindows)) { tw->setParent(magicalParent(tw), magicalWindowFlags(tw)); settings.restoreGeometry(tw, tw->geometryHint()); tw->action()->setChecked(tw->isVisible()); @@ -518,7 +515,7 @@ void QDesignerWorkbench::switchToTopLevelMode() m_actionManager->setBringAllToFrontVisible(true); - foreach (QDesignerFormWindow *fw, m_formWindows) { + for (QDesignerFormWindow *fw : qAsConst(m_formWindows)) { fw->setParent(magicalParent(fw), magicalWindowFlags(fw)); fw->setAttribute(Qt::WA_DeleteOnClose, true); const PositionMap::const_iterator pit = m_Positions.constFind(fw); @@ -628,7 +625,7 @@ void QDesignerWorkbench::initializeCorePlugins() QList<QObject*> plugins = QPluginLoader::staticInstances(); plugins += core()->pluginManager()->instances(); - foreach (QObject *plugin, plugins) { + for (QObject *plugin : qAsConst(plugins)) { if (QDesignerFormEditorPluginInterface *formEditorPlugin = qobject_cast<QDesignerFormEditorPluginInterface*>(plugin)) { if (!formEditorPlugin->isInitialized()) formEditorPlugin->initialize(core()); @@ -653,7 +650,7 @@ void QDesignerWorkbench::saveGeometries(QDesignerSettings &settings) const case TopLevelMode: settings.setToolBarsState(m_mode, m_topLevelData.toolbarManager->saveState(MainWindowBase::settingsVersion())); settings.setMainWindowState(m_mode, widgetBoxToolWindow()->saveState(MainWindowBase::settingsVersion())); - foreach (const QDesignerToolWindow *tw, m_toolWindows) + for (const QDesignerToolWindow *tw : m_toolWindows) settings.saveGeometryFor(tw); break; case NeutralMode: @@ -683,7 +680,7 @@ bool QDesignerWorkbench::saveForm(QDesignerFormWindowInterface *frm) QDesignerFormWindow *QDesignerWorkbench::findFormWindow(QWidget *widget) const { - foreach (QDesignerFormWindow *formWindow, m_formWindows) { + for (QDesignerFormWindow *formWindow : m_formWindows) { if (formWindow->editor() == widget) return formWindow; } @@ -695,7 +692,7 @@ bool QDesignerWorkbench::handleClose() { m_state = StateClosing; QList<QDesignerFormWindow *> dirtyForms; - foreach (QDesignerFormWindow *w, m_formWindows) { + for (QDesignerFormWindow *w : qAsConst(m_formWindows)) { if (w->editor()->isDirty()) dirtyForms << w; } @@ -722,7 +719,7 @@ bool QDesignerWorkbench::handleClose() m_state = StateUp; return false; case QMessageBox::Save: - foreach (QDesignerFormWindow *fw, dirtyForms) { + for (QDesignerFormWindow *fw : qAsConst(dirtyForms)) { fw->show(); fw->raise(); if (!fw->close()) { @@ -732,7 +729,7 @@ bool QDesignerWorkbench::handleClose() } break; case QMessageBox::Discard: - foreach (QDesignerFormWindow *fw, dirtyForms) { + for (QDesignerFormWindow *fw : qAsConst(dirtyForms)) { fw->editor()->setDirty(false); fw->setWindowModified(false); } @@ -741,7 +738,7 @@ bool QDesignerWorkbench::handleClose() } } - foreach (QDesignerFormWindow *fw, m_formWindows) + for (QDesignerFormWindow *fw : qAsConst(m_formWindows)) fw->close(); saveSettings(); @@ -799,7 +796,7 @@ void QDesignerWorkbench::formWindowActionTriggered(QAction *a) void QDesignerWorkbench::closeAllToolWindows() { - foreach (QDesignerToolWindow *tw, m_toolWindows) + for (QDesignerToolWindow *tw : qAsConst(m_toolWindows)) tw->hide(); } @@ -853,9 +850,9 @@ void QDesignerWorkbench::bringAllToFront() { if (m_mode != TopLevelMode) return; - foreach(QDesignerToolWindow *tw, m_toolWindows) + for (QDesignerToolWindow *tw : qAsConst(m_toolWindows)) raiseWindow(tw); - foreach(QDesignerFormWindow *dfw, m_formWindows) + for (QDesignerFormWindow *dfw : qAsConst(m_formWindows)) raiseWindow(dfw); } @@ -1092,7 +1089,7 @@ void QDesignerWorkbench::restoreUISettings() if (font == m_toolWindows.front()->font()) return; - foreach(QDesignerToolWindow *tw, m_toolWindows) + for (QDesignerToolWindow *tw : qAsConst(m_toolWindows)) tw->setFont(font); } |